Katheryn Loewen

Katheryn is an avid cyclist with a love for the outdoors. Born and raised in Manitoba, she is a dedicated four-season bike commuter that learned to enjoy getting around the city on two wheels, no matter the weather. After completing a Bachelor of Arts in Music with a focus on Music Therapy, she spent two months cycling with friends to St. John’s, NL, slowly experiencing some of the many faces of Canada and getting to know people and communities along the way. Katheryn spent time working as a bike mechanic and became involved with the cycling community in Winnipeg, then moved to Windsor, Ontario and worked with a local cycling advocacy group managing their community bike shop, the Bike Kitchen. Through this position, Katheryn discovered a passion for active transportation advocacy and non-profit work.

When she’s not fixing or riding bikes, she can be found playing the banjo, petting cats, and sewing. Katheryn is excited to have returned to Winnipeg and is looking forward to connecting with people about sustainable transportation issues in the area.
